There is an article in the November 8 issue of PEOPLE Magazine, page 127, entitled "Teen Titans." The article honors teenaged entrepreneurs. One of those honored is Timothy Hampson, the proud owner of cuddlypuppy.com, an Internet dog-selling operation. The young "titan" buys dogs from "a network of breeders" (i.e., puppy mills) and sells them over the Internet to anyone who sends him money. His mother even helps him! The young man says he hopes to expand into dog clothing and exotic pets.
